191 NGC VF Commodus Roman Alexandria Egypt Tetradrachm Athena R3 (21092005C)Very Fine Alexandria Roman Egypt billon silver tetradrachm coin. Struck for Emperor Commodus, son of Marcus Aurelius. Minted in the Emperor's 32nd Alexandrian year L B = 191 2 CE. Emmett: 2521 32, rated R3 (range is R1 to R5). Certified by NGC to VF. Obverse: laureate head of emperor facing right. Reverse: Athena seated left on shield holding scepter in left hand and supporting Nike (Victory) upright in right hand, flanked by date letters L B = 32.
